Because downtown areas are also often among the oldest parts of a community, they have been burdened by decades of regulations, some of which can impede or frustrate the development of dense urban housing. One code that I reviewed a few years ago contained over 100 pages, including endless lists of permitted and conditional uses, special districts, tables, charts, cross-references, numerous definitions, and other minutiae that would discourage even the most seasoned of development companies.
